AliExpress

Aliexpress is a marketplace for consumers, resellers, and sellers where consumers can purchase any item of their choice. It has a wide selection of categories such as home and garden, men’s clothing, women’s clothing, beauty and health, and much more. Although most people believe Aliexpress is a true dropship supplier, they aren’t. Instead, it’s an online retail arbitrage platform. Sellers usually from China get their products from a direct supplier. The supplier marks up the price of the product and lists it on Aliexpress. You then further markup the product and sell it on your Shopify store.

Pros

  • Very cheap products
  • Easy to find trending products

Cons

  • Slow shipping times
  • Low-quality products
  • False advertisement on the product page or confusing description
  • Customer service isn’t good

Spocket

For dropshippers who are tired of the old Aliexpress method of dropshipping, Spocket is an excellent alternative. With this platform, the app only has suppliers primarily from the U.S., U.K., and E.U. The remaining suppliers are Australia, New Zealand, and Germany. Although you aren’t getting a direct supplier relationship, Spocket does have special discounts with each supplier.

Pros

  • Fast shipping to customers who live in the U.S, E.U, and U.K.
  • All products have been thoroughly quality tested
  • Able to use with Shopify and WooCommerce
  • A free plan is available
  • Automates out of stock inventory
  • Automates pricing markups for supplier price changes

Cons

  • Not ideal for shipping to countries outside of the U.S., U.K., or E.U.
  • Unable to sell these products on eBay Amazon, Etsy, Wish, and Groupon.

Printful

If you’re interested in selling print on demand products, then the Printful platform may be right for you. This platform provides everything from the designing process to the order fulfillment for customer items and accessories online. Printful has a mockup generator where you can add your designs onto your items such as shirts, hoodies, hats, necklaces, bags, slippers, and phone cases.

This platform makes it easy to sell because it works with the dropshipping method. You don’t have to hold any inventory, simply place the orders once your customer has ordered.

Pros

  • Fast shipping to U.S.
  • Easy way to get started with Print-on-Demand
  • Able to order samples
  • Choose from their wide selection of items such as posters, beach towels, pillowcases, etc.
  • A ton of integrations such as Wish, Weebly, WooCommerce, Wix, Squarespace and much more

Cons

  • Limited in color and art placement
  • Expensive costs
  • Shipping outside of the U.S. is inconvenient and expensive

Salehoo

Salehoo is a wholesale and dropshipping directory that includes over 2.5 million products and over 8,000 suppliers. This platform allows users to find products and compare suppliers. Many of the suppliers are located in various countries such as the U.S., U.K., Australia, Canada, and China. You will, however, need to contact these suppliers directly and negotiate a cost that works with you. There is a $67 for one year access or $127 for lifetime access. Many of the suppliers on their platforms do not have a minimum order or application fee, which is conducive for dropshippers.

Many dropshippers who want to move to create their own brand typically will like to start wholesaling. In this scenario, Salehoo can be an excellent option for intermediate and even advanced dropshippers.

Pros

  • Have direct communication with the supplier to ensure quality and negotiate pricing
  • Access to a massive pool of products and verified suppliers
  • All suppliers are verified and legitimate
  • 60-day money-back guarantee
  • Able to transition to wholesaling

Cons

  • Costs you money to find suppliers
  • Certain products are overpriced and maybe cheaper on other platforms
  • No search criteria to find suppliers in specific countries such as the U.S, U.K., and Canada

Inventory Source

Inventory source is a dropship provider that provides access to over 1.6 billion products with over 230 dropship suppliers. The service allows you to automatically sync your inventory to Shopify and automatically process orders. This platform is ideal for individuals who want to higher-quality e-commerce suppliers by sourcing from U.S. dropship suppliers and leading reputable brands.

Pros

  • Vast product selection
  • High-quality products
  • Order automation
  • Sync product inventory

Cons

  • A monthly subscription of $99 or $150 per month

Best Dropshippers For Shopify – Wrapping Up

Choosing a supplier is a very significant decision in your Dropshipping journey. This is because your customer satisfaction and retention are reliant on the quality of products and speed of delivery. For beginner dropshippers who are just learning the ropes of e-commerce, Aliexpress is serviceable. However, as you gain more sales, you’ll quickly realize customers begin to complain about long shipping times, bad packaging, or poor quality of products. They might even see an invoice slip with Chinese characters on it.

Many customers in the U.S. are getting comfortable with Amazon Prime’s two-day shipping. As a result, you may want to find higher quality dropship suppliers based in the U.S. If you want to start a Print on Demand store, then Printful is the right option. It comes down to your priority and goals. To build a long-term e-commerce brand, it’s worth spending the money to find quality suppliers who can help you brand your product for you.
